The shoulder is evaluated based on the limited range of motion without pain, weakness and/or fatigue during the C&P exam, not how many times you were seen while on active duty or how severe the initial injury was. VA pays disability compensation based on the CURRENT residuals of that injury or disease.

SpletPain is the main problem initially. It can be worse in bed and disturb sleep. The pain gradually improves, but stiffness slowly worsens and becomes the main problem. The stiffness then gradually resolves. Frozen shoulder is usually self-limiting, but it can take months to years to resolve. Advise on activity modification and pain control.
